This note covers regeneration of the Stillmark static-analysis baseline file. Maintainers must rebuild the baseline only from a clean checkout, since stale artifacts inflate the suppression list and hide genuine findings. After regeneration, upload the file to the Verity archive service, which validates checksums before acceptance. Authenticate the upload using the token below.

portal login ticket: eyJhbGciOiJIUzI1NiIsInR5cCI6IkpXVCJ9.eyJzdWIiOiI0Z4ywpUMsBIn0.ca5FVhkdBXa3

# Capacity Decision — Drenholt Plant (Managers Only)

After reviewing utilisation data, Ferralux will expand line capacity at the Drenholt plant by 30% rather than commission a second site. The decision reflects lower capital outlay, existing workforce depth, and proximity to the Calder rail corridor. Branch managers should plan for staggered downtime in weeks 14–16 during retooling. Hiring freezes elsewhere remain in place. The broader commercial reasoning is summarised confidentially below.

board note of fahif-yahog: Gross margin on Wenath came in at 10 percent against a plan of 5 percent. Only 3 of the 100 pilot accounts renewed Wenath, so a churn review is set for July 15.

## Monthly Partitioning — Maintenance Fragment

The Cragmoor events table is partitioned by calendar month. A scheduled job creates next month's partition on the 25th; if it fails, create the partition manually before month-end or inserts will error. Old partitions are detached after 13 months and archived to cold storage. To create or detach partitions by hand, connect to the primary using the connection string below.

replica DSN, kajep-yahag: mssql://praok_svc:iF@db-8d68.plorvaio.local:5432/eliion

// LIFT_DISPATCH_TICK_MS controls the simulation step for the Verrow
// elevator-dispatch simulator used by the Calden Tower modeling team.
// Lowering this value increases fidelity but also amplifies floating-point
// drift in the car-position integrator, which the fairness auditor treats
// as a potential side channel for inferring passenger load. Do not change
// this without re-running the deterministic replay suite, since recorded
// traces are keyed to the tick rate. The exact build used to validate the
// current value is recorded below.

build token for hafop-fawif: htk31_9758d5e565aa3b14f55d629377373c4